A student can demonstrate word recognition primarily through the ability to determine how to pronounce printed words. Word recognition is a crucial component of reading fluency and comprehension, as it involves the ability to identify and articulate words accurately and quickly. When students can recognize words visually and pronounce them correctly, it enables them to focus on understanding the meaning of the text rather than spending excessive time decoding each word.

Understanding grammatical rules, pinpointing the meanings of complex vocabulary, and constructing detailed summaries of texts are all important skills in the broader context of language arts but do not directly illustrate the foundational aspect of word recognition itself. These skills build upon the ability to recognize words, which is essential for effective reading and communication.
